Massage therapy suite marketing groundwork.

We begin this lesson not by marketing but by focusing. Focusing on what? Set your sights, and your efforts, on your mission statement and your target audience. Without knowing your purpose and the people you are aiming at, any marketing program you devise will surely miss the mark.

Take the time, right now, to write out a mission statement, if you do not have one already.  What is your goal? What will be your “true North” as you go forward? A mission statement is a one-or-two sentence statement of your purpose.  It can go something like this: to provide the best customer service possible to working women.  And within that statement, you will notice, the target audience has been named.

Which now brings us to your marketing campaign, on a budget, aimed at working women in your city.

A few suggestions for you to consider.

The year is 2024. The old ways of marketing are antiquated and not terribly effective.  We are talking about newspaper ads, radio ads, television ads, billboards.  Mind you, they have their place, and at times they serve their purpose, but they are also expensive, and they splatter across all population segments. They are not specific in their aim, and that means far too often they miss the mark.

In today’s world, these are the most effective marketing approaches:

  • Content marketing
  • Social media marketing
  • Search engine optimization
  • Email marketing and newsletters
  • Team with an influencer
  • Landing pages

Please notice, almost all of these suggestions are related to the digital world, so the sooner you acquaint yourself with the internet, the web, and the influence they yield, the better.  These are inexpensive approaches to marketing, comparatively speaking, and they give you the best chance at reaching your marketing.

And, we would be remiss, if we did not mention one other approach:

Be the best massage therapy technician/professional you can be.  Never underestimate the power of word of mouth in promoting your business.
